Requirements
  • The candidate must meet current qualifications under federal Clinical Laboratory Improvement Amendments Act of 1988 requirements, Oregon Department of Human Services regulations, College of American Pathologists standards, and Joint Commission standards.
  • A Bachelor of Science degree in Medical Technology or Clinical Laboratory Science is required.
  • The candidate must have working knowledge of laboratory information systems and hospital information systems, specialized automated analyzers, centrifuges, pipettors, microscopes, and the Pevco pneumatic system.
  • The candidate must demonstrate the ability to use a personal computer and position-applicable software programs.
  • The candidate must demonstrate the ability to operate applicable office equipment and telephones.
  • The candidate must maintain confidentiality and work independently with minimal supervision.
  • The candidate must demonstrate general knowledge of standard medical laboratory techniques, procedures, and safety precautions.
  • The candidate must demonstrate organizational ability, multitasking, and critical-thinking skills.
  • The candidate must have legible handwriting.
  • The candidate must maintain regular, consistent, and punctual attendance at the assigned job location.
  • The candidate must be able to sit, stand, walk, bend, squat, reach, and stretch frequently.
  • The candidate may be required to lift up to 40 pounds.
  • The candidate must use standard precautions because of potential exposure to blood and body fluids.
  • The candidate must communicate effectively by reading, writing, and speaking in person or by telephone.
  • The candidate must demonstrate manual dexterity.

Bay Area Hospital is a community hospital serving Coos Bay and surrounding communities on the southern Oregon coast. It provides emergency care, surgery, imaging, rehabilitation, inpatient treatment and a range of medical specialties. Clinical and support teams coordinate hospital-based and outpatient services for patients who might otherwise travel farther for care. The organization’s regional role centers on maintaining accessible healthcare infrastructure and clinical services for the communities in its service area.
